The Most Likely Destination for LeBron James in Free Agency 2026

According to Brian Windhorst from ESPN, "The King" seems to be staying with the Lakers due to the lack of alternatives in the market.

Everything points to LeBron James staying with the Los Angeles Lakers, not necessarily because it's the perfect choice, but because the current market hardly offers a realistic alternative for a 41-year-old star still playing at an All-NBA level.

During the Draft Combine in Chicago, the general feeling among executives, scouts, and strategists was clear: there is no obvious destination for James outside of Los Angeles. Teams with cap space, like the Chicago Bulls or Brooklyn Nets, seem uninterested in building around a veteran nearing 42 years old.

And franchises historically linked to LeBron —such as the Golden State Warriors, Cleveland Cavaliers, or New York Knicks— simply do not have the financial flexibility needed to offer him a suitable contract without drastically altering their rosters.

Nevertheless, there is still immense respect within the league for his competitive level. Executives and analysts believe that James remains one of the top 25 players in the NBA when he is physically at his best. Last season, he was an All-Star again, earned 52 million dollars, and was instrumental in helping the Lakers secure home-court advantage in the playoffs.

The Advantages for the Lakers

For the Lakers, renewing his contract seems both a sporting and a commercial decision. The arrival of the new owner, Mark Walter, also influences this logic: LeBron continues to be one of the most profitable figures in global sports, drives TV audiences, sells tickets, and maintains the franchise's global relevance.

The most likely scenario would be a short contract, possibly for one year, with a high salary and a no-trade clause. What almost no one in the league expects is for James to agree to sign for a mid-level exception —around 15 million dollars— to join another contender.

Moreover, from a sporting perspective, the Lakers also do not have many clear paths to improve their roster without LeBron. The continuity of players like Austin Reaves, Rui Hachimura, and Marcus Smart seems more logical than embarking on a sudden rebuild.
